Was The Help filmed in Jackson MS?
Filming took place in Mississippi, and the main host cities – Greenwood and Jackson – are still eager to guide visitors to locations from the movie and novel. (Some scenes were also shot in Clarksdale and Greenville). Here’s how to visit The Help filming locations in Mississippi.
Why did Charlotte Fire Constantine in The Help?
When Skeeter was away at college, Charlotte had been forced to fire Constantine to save face because Rachel disobeyed her orders to go around back into in the kitchen while having a luncheon with the Daughters of America.
What song is Jeremy playing in Get Out?
13 SERIOUSLY, RUN! We later learn that this is Jeremy Armitage (Caleb Landry Jones), the youngest member of the evil Armitage clan. When Jeremy stops his car and pulls over to abduct Andre, Jeremy is listening to the Flanagan and Allen song, “Run Rabbit Run.”
What does Get Out symbolize?
Get Out is loaded with symbols and imagery that remind us of the history of slavery and the Old South – starting with the plantation-like Armitage Estate and some older-looking costumes. The echoes visually remind us that our society’s past is ever interwoven into our present.
Where is Skeeters house from The Help?
Skeeter Phelan’s home: Skeeter’s house was actually filmed in two places. The exterior of her farm house is Whittington Farm, at 7300 County Road 518 (Money Road). The interior of the home was the Franklin Residence, 613 River Road. Hilly Holbrook’s house: The Johnson residence at 413 Grand Blvd.

What does the deer symbolize in Get Out?
Deer (symbol) For Chris, the deer symbolizes loss, helplessness, and his mother. When they arrive at the Armitage house, Dean Armitage rails against deers, saying that they are taking over everything and they need to be killed.

How many songs are in the movie the help?
The Help, released on 8 Aug 2011, consists of a playlist of 13 credited songs, from various artists including Johnny Cash & June Carter Cash, Dorothy Norwood and Ray Charles. The original score is composed by Thomas Newman.
